Toutefois, l\u2019utilisation du Dichlorom\u00e9thane a depuis \u00e9t\u00e9 consid\u00e9rablement restreinte (r\u00e8glement REACH, directive sur l\u2019eau potable). <\/p><\/blockquote>\n<p>Il n&rsquo;existe pas d&rsquo;estimations actuelles concernant l&rsquo;exposition professionnelle au Dichlorom\u00e9thane dans l&rsquo;UE. Les principales voies d&rsquo;exposition sur le lieu de travail sont les voies respiratoires et la peau. Le Dichlorom\u00e9thane est class\u00e9, conform\u00e9ment au r\u00e8glement CLP, comme substance canc\u00e9rog\u00e8ne de cat\u00e9gorie 2. Le CIRC classe cette substance parmi les substances canc\u00e9rog\u00e8nes du groupe 2A (probablement canc\u00e9rog\u00e8nes pour l\u2019homme). Le Dichlorom\u00e9thane est soup\u00e7onn\u00e9 d\u2019\u00eatre \u00e0 l\u2019origine de cancers du pancr\u00e9as, du poumon et du foie.    <\/p>\n<h2>O\u00f9 se situent les risques ?<\/h2>\n<p>Le dichlorom\u00e9thane est principalement utilis\u00e9 comme d\u00e9capant pour peinture, d\u00e9graissant, propulseur, r\u00e9frig\u00e9rant et solvant d&rsquo;extraction. Il est tr\u00e8s volatil, dissout de nombreuses substances organiques et est donc \u00e9galement utilis\u00e9 comme solvant pour les r\u00e9sines, les graisses, les plastiques et le bitume. Il sert \u00e9galement d&rsquo;adh\u00e9sif pour des applications sp\u00e9ciales (verre acrylique, polystyr\u00e8ne).  <\/p>\n<p>Le Dichlorom\u00e9thane est tr\u00e8s volatil, ce qui signifie que, lorsqu\u2019il est utilis\u00e9 sur une grande surface, des concentrations \u00e9lev\u00e9es peuvent rapidement s\u2019accumuler dans l\u2019air et \u00eatre inhal\u00e9es. Lors de telles applications \u00e0 grande \u00e9chelle, comme le d\u00e9graissage ou le collage de surfaces (en plastique), des concentrations \u00e9lev\u00e9es de Dichlorom\u00e9thane peuvent encore \u00eatre pr\u00e9sentes dans l\u2019air que vous respirez. Des expositions de forte intensit\u00e9 sont possibles pour les travailleurs qui utilisent des d\u00e9capants pour peinture (secteur de la construction, r\u00e9novation) et lors de t\u00e2ches telles que le nettoyage de cuves, le d\u00e9graissage ou l\u2019entretien en espace confin\u00e9. Des expositions d\u2019intensit\u00e9 moyenne sont courantes dans la fabrication de produits chimiques, la production pharmaceutique et la formulation de solvants, tandis que des expositions de faible intensit\u00e9 peuvent \u00eatre observ\u00e9es dans les laboratoires d\u2019analyse, de recherche et de sant\u00e9, pour le personnel de laboratoire et dans l\u2019industrie pharmaceutique (agents d\u2019extraction), ainsi que lors de traitements de surfaces en plastique \u00e0 l\u2019aide d\u2019agents d\u00e9graissants et d\u2019adh\u00e9sifs.   <\/p>\n<h2>En savoir plus sur la substance<\/h2>\n<p>Le dichlorom\u00e9thane est un hydrocarbure aliphatique satur\u00e9 halog\u00e9n\u00e9 qui, \u00e0 l&rsquo;\u00e9tat pur, se pr\u00e9sente sous la forme d&rsquo;un liquide incolore d\u00e9gageant une odeur semblable \u00e0 celle du chloroforme. Il pr\u00e9sente un point d&rsquo;\u00e9bullition bas de 40 \u00b0C et une pression de vapeur de 470 hPa (\u00e0 20 \u00b0C) ; il est tr\u00e8s volatil. Lors de l\u2019utilisation de produits contenant du Dichlorom\u00e9thane, environ 85 % de la substance est rejet\u00e9e dans l\u2019environnement. Dans des conditions normales d\u2019utilisation, le Dichlorom\u00e9thane n\u2019est pas inflammable ; toutefois, il peut pr\u00e9senter un risque d\u2019explosion dans des r\u00e9cipients ferm\u00e9s.   <\/p>\n<p>En raison des restrictions d&rsquo;utilisation pr\u00e9vues par le r\u00e8glement REACH, les d\u00e9capants pour peinture contenant plus de 0,1 % en poids de Dichlorom\u00e9thane ne peuvent \u00eatre utilis\u00e9s \u00e0 des fins professionnelles que par du personnel ayant suivi une formation sp\u00e9cifique. La combustion du Dichlorom\u00e9thane peut produire du phosg\u00e8ne gazeux, une substance hautement toxique. <\/p>\n<h2>Dangers pouvant survenir<\/h2>\n<p>Si la substance est absorb\u00e9e sous forme liquide, par exemple par la peau, elle affecte principalement le syst\u00e8me nerveux central et provoque des sympt\u00f4mes tels que des maux de t\u00eate, des vertiges, des naus\u00e9es, des engourdissements et des troubles de la concentration. Dans l&rsquo;organisme, le Dichlorom\u00e9thane est transform\u00e9 en monoxyde de carbone, provoquant ainsi une intoxication au monoxyde de carbone. Une irritation des voies respiratoires et des yeux, une perte d&rsquo;app\u00e9tit, des troubles de la concentration et de la fatigue peuvent \u00e9galement survenir.  <\/p>\n<p>Un contact cutan\u00e9 prolong\u00e9 entra\u00eene la d\u00e9gradation des tissus adipeux, provoquant ainsi des \u00e9ruptions cutan\u00e9es et des d\u00e9mangeaisons. Les vapeurs de Dichlorom\u00e9thane sont plus lourdes que l&rsquo;air et s&rsquo;accumulent donc pr\u00e8s du sol. L&rsquo;inhalation de ces vapeurs peut causer des l\u00e9sions au niveau du nerf optique et du foie (h\u00e9patite).  <\/p>\n<p>L&rsquo;effet le plus significatif d&rsquo;une exposition \u00e0 long terme est la canc\u00e9rog\u00e9nicit\u00e9. Le Dichlorom\u00e9thane est soup\u00e7onn\u00e9 d&rsquo;\u00eatre \u00e0 l&rsquo;origine de cancers du pancr\u00e9as, du poumon et du foie. <\/p>\n<p><strong>Les d\u00e9lais de latence avant l&rsquo;apparition d&rsquo;un cancer suite \u00e0 une exposition au Dichlorom\u00e9thane peuvent varier de 20 \u00e0 30 ans.<\/strong><\/p>\n<h2>Ce que vous pouvez faire<\/h2>\n<p>Avant toute chose, vous devez v\u00e9rifier si les produits contenant du Dichlorom\u00e9thane peuvent \u00eatre remplac\u00e9s par des alternatives moins dangereuses ou non dangereuses. Il existe une grande vari\u00e9t\u00e9 de produits de substitution, notamment pour une utilisation comme propulseur. Si aucun substitut n\u2019est disponible, des mesures de sant\u00e9 et de s\u00e9curit\u00e9 appropri\u00e9es doivent \u00eatre mises en \u0153uvre, en particulier pour les applications \u00e0 grande \u00e9chelle, afin de prot\u00e9ger les travailleurs expos\u00e9s. Les vapeurs doivent \u00eatre capt\u00e9es et extraites \u00e0 la source ou pr\u00e8s du sol \u00e0 l\u2019aide de syst\u00e8mes d\u2019extraction. Le nombre de personnes expos\u00e9es et la dur\u00e9e d\u2019exposition doivent \u00eatre r\u00e9duits au minimum. Les travailleurs expos\u00e9s doivent recevoir r\u00e9guli\u00e8rement des consignes, formul\u00e9es de mani\u00e8re compr\u00e9hensible, sur les risques li\u00e9s au Dichlorom\u00e9thane et sur la mise en \u0153uvre des mesures de protection. Une fois que toutes les mesures mentionn\u00e9es ont \u00e9t\u00e9 mises en \u0153uvre, l\u2019absorption de Dichlorom\u00e9thane par l\u2019organisme peut \u00eatre encore r\u00e9duite gr\u00e2ce \u00e0 l\u2019utilisation d\u2019\u00e9quipements de protection individuelle (EPI) et de v\u00eatements de travail adapt\u00e9s. Les EPI et les v\u00eatements de travail doivent pouvoir \u00eatre nettoy\u00e9s et entrepos\u00e9s dans des conditions d\u2019hygi\u00e8ne satisfaisantes. Lors de l\u2019utilisation d\u2019une protection respiratoire et de gants, il convient de respecter les instructions du fabricant concernant l\u2019ad\u00e9quation, la manipulation, l\u2019entretien, le nettoyage et le temps de perc\u00e9e.        <\/p>\n<p><em>R\u00e9f\u00e9rences : OCDE, ECHA ; EU-OSHA, Gestis, CE, UBA.<\/em><\/p>\n","protected":false},"template":"","carcinogens":[1758],"class_list":["post-106506","fact","type-fact","status-publish","hentry","carcinogens-dichloromethane-fr"],"yoast_head":"<!-- This site is optimized with the Yoast SEO Premium plugin v27.9 (Yoast SEO v27.9) - https:\/\/yoast.com\/product\/yoast-seo-premium-wordpress\/ -->\n<title>Dichlorom\u00e9thane - STOP carcinogens at work<\/title>\n<meta name=\"description\" content=\"Be aware of what you work with!
